Hurricane Norbert strengthens to Category 3 storm

By Associated Press
Saturday, October 11, 2008 -

PUERTO SAN CARLOS, Mexico - As Norbert bore down on Mexico’s southern Baja California peninsula, it gathered strength overnight and was classified as a Category 3 hurricane early Saturday.

The U.S. National Hurricane Center in Miami said Norbert became better organized overnight and its winds grew to 115 mph (185 kph). As of 5 a.m. EDT, the hurricane’s center was located about 90 miles (145 kilometers) south of Cabo San Lazaro and about 145 miles (235 kilometers) west-southwest of La Paz.
